Qualcomm Secures Key AR Chip Deals with Meta, Snap, Samsung
Summary
Qualcomm announced it will supply chips and components for smartglasses to major players including Meta, Snap, and Samsung. This positions Qualcomm as a key enabler in the evolving augmented reality (AR) eyewear market. The news also reiterates the previously announced deal to supply Dragonfly C1000 data center CPUs to Meta, targeting H2 2028 production. Securing these AR design wins with prominent customers is a significant step in Qualcomm's diversification strategy beyond its core smartphone business.
